Dec 26, 2025 Explore the chaotic landscape of 2025's media world, from significant layoffs at major news outlets to a fierce internal divide among MAGA media figures. The bidding war for Warner Bros. Discovery heats up, while AI's influence reshapes content creation and trust. Tech giants face scrutiny as they seemingly bow to Trump, navigating settlements and policy changes. Amidst this turmoil, independent media gains traction as consumers push back against corporate dominance, hinting at a shifting power dynamic in the industry.

Bezos' Cold Shoulder At The Washington Post
- Jon recounts Jeff Bezos' alleged meddling at the Washington Post and the resulting staff departures and subscriber losses.
- He notes the Post still produced major reporting like the Pete Hegseth airstrikes story despite opinion turmoil.
Owners Pushed Papers Rightward
- Several newspaper owners shifted rightward in 2025, altering newsroom direction and prompting departures.
- The Wall Street Journal editorial board stood out by forcefully criticizing Trump while others swung toward MAGA positions.
Paramount Purchase Upended CBS News
- Jon describes turmoil at CBS News after David Ellison acquired Paramount and installed Barry Weiss, prompting executive exits.
- He characterizes the 60 Minutes retraction settlement and deal-making as a major black eye for the network.
